Hi how different is it from the dac found on the LG g8x. I see they have the same dac.
@drfappingston
@drfappingston 3 года назад
Though the DAC chip may be the same, there are a slew of other components in the BTR5 that serve to increase the sound quality and reduce any unwanted noise or distortion, also utilizing top of the line Bluetooth components I'd imagine there wouldn't be much to compare... Granted, I don't have any experience with the LG G8X. The BTR5 has 2 DACs, whereas I assume the LG only has one. On it's own, that's not a huge deal given that only 1 of the 2 chips is used with the the 3.5mm port on the BTR5, the second remains idle unless you're using a 2.5mm balanced connection. The amps power delivery on either is very impressive for the size, price and convenience of the BTR5. Manually adjustable high and low gain settings, I've seen numerous reports around of people having no issue running higher impedance headphones through the Fiio... Especially considering you're getting (nearly?) twice the power output with a balanced connection, but I do not have anything that requires more power than the 3.5mm on high gain can provide... All my IEMs are on 3.5mm low gain, generally around 30/60 volume. I did buy a balanced IEM cable to try with my Moondrop Starfields, and during the brief testing that I did, I couldn't tell any appreciable difference in sound quality-- I am certainly no expert though, nor are my IEMs top of the line. My Sennheiser HD599s are sufficient around 50-60/60 on low gain, but can get ridiculously loud on high gain. Granted, the HD599s aren't super difficult to run. They can be used with a smartphone 3.5mm, but they're pretty quiet at max volume. I hope that helps you in some way... I am absolutely impressed with all that the BTR5 offers and do not hesitate to recommend it to anyone with even the slightest interest in higher quality audio. At the price point (and honestly beyond), I couldn't imagine getting much more in one package.
